FIG. 18. Microscopic preparation of an injected branchial filament of a 70- pound Polyodon as seen from above. The respiratory filament vessels are stippled and the lymphatic network (nutrient filament veins?), which are shown only in part, are drawn in outline. X 5- Reduced \.
FI
...G. ISa. A portion of the filament respiratory network. X45O- Reduced |.
FIG. 19. Dorsal view of the lymphatic (nutrient venous?) network of a 70- pound Polyodon. This network is superficial to the septa that contains the res- piratory network, and for the most part the transverse vessels run parallel to the spaces separating the respiratory septa. Its meshes are more irregular and very much coarser (compare with Fig. 18). A longitudinal filament lymphatic trunk (nutrient filament vein?) receives the network from the two opposite fila- ments.
